MR WATTERS’ CONCERT

Mr. Watters has arranged a most interesting programme for his concert at the Opera House on November 15th. A number of new songs by the best composers are included as well as some by the old masters. Miss Naomi Whalley will sing "The Wren,” with ; flute obligato played by Mr. C. G. Swallow, who will also render a flute solo. “The Wren" is a brilliant number which will display Miss Whalley’s voice at its best. Miss Whalley is also to appear in a bracket of three quaint novelty songs, which will be now to Palmerston audiences but which are certain to be immensely popular. Dress circle and orchestral stall tickets are obtainable at Cole’s, Berryman’s and Swallow’s.
